St. Cyr Tops Podium at Lost Valley

AUBURN, Maine – University of Maine at Farmington sophomore Rosie St. Cyr (Pownal, Maine) had a successful Sunday, earning the top spot in a Reynolds Division slalom event hosted at Lost Valley.

St. Cyr was the lone Beaver to complete both runs, and Farmington did not place as a team. Saint Joseph's College of Maine earned the team victory, with its three scoring skiers combining for a time of 3:31.26. Bowdoin College finished second, while the University of Maine placed third.

St. Cyr delivered a pair of flawless runs en route to earning her first gold medal of the season. She was the fastest skier on the course by nearly two seconds, posting a combined time of 1:05.67. St. Cyr completed her first run in 33.73 seconds and followed with a 31.94-second second run.

Senior Hokulani Caroselli (Temple, Maine) did not finish her first run but responded with a strong second run, finishing in 33.15 seconds, the second-fastest time of any skier on the course.

UP NEXT

Farmington returns to the hill next Saturday for day one of a two-day Reynolds Division event at Pleasant Mountain in Bridgton, Maine.
